Features & Benefits

What makes this frizz-control serum genuinely interesting is how it works — not by sitting on top of the hair like a heavy coating, but by using Alpha Keratin 60ku protein to physically fill in the tiny gaps and cracks along each hair's cuticle. Think of it like spackling rough plaster: smoother surface, less friction, less frizz. It's a lightweight liquid, so even those with fine or wavy hair shouldn't notice extra weight or limpness. It works across a broad spectrum of hair types, and because the formula is color-safe, it fits naturally into routines built around dyed or highlighted hair. No rinsing, no extra steps.

User Feedback

Curly-haired users — particularly those in the 3a to 3c range — tend to report the strongest results, praising the noticeable frizz reduction and the non-greasy finish that doesn't interfere with curl definition. The scent gets consistent compliments. That said, the honest criticism comes down to size and value: 2oz disappears fast if you have long, thick hair, and some buyers feel the price-per-ounce doesn't justify repeat purchases at full price. A few reviewers noted mixed results on very fine hair, reporting that the protein feel was heavier than expected. Buildup from daily use is occasionally flagged, suggesting that spacing out applications tends to work better.

Suitable for:

The Virtue Un-Frizz 2oz Leave-In Hair Treatment is a strong fit for anyone with curly, wavy, or chemically processed hair who deals with frizz as a daily frustration rather than an occasional inconvenience. If you live somewhere humid — the kind of place where freshly styled hair starts to puff up within an hour of stepping outside — the protein-based approach here is more structurally sound than a typical silicone coating. It works particularly well for hair in the 2c to 3c curl range, where the cuticle tends to be naturally more lifted and porous, making it receptive to the gap-filling protein this formula delivers. Color-treated and highlighted hair also benefits, since chemical processing opens the cuticle further and a gentle, sulfate-free leave-in helps maintain both moisture and color integrity without stripping. The compact 2oz size makes it a natural choice for travelers, minimalists, or anyone who wants to trial the formula before committing to a larger version.

Not suitable for:

If you have thick, long hair that requires a generous application to see real results, the Virtue Un-Frizz 2oz Leave-In Hair Treatment may feel like a poor value proposition — the bottle simply does not contain enough product for heavy or frequent use. Buyers expecting drugstore-level pricing for a travel-sized item will likely find the cost-per-ounce difficult to justify, especially if they need to reorder on a regular basis. Those with very fine, straight hair may find the protein concentration leaves a slightly stiff or weighed-down feel, since fine hair is generally more sensitive to protein accumulation than coarser textures. If your frizz concern is mild — occasional flyaways on an otherwise manageable head of hair — the price point here may not align with the problem you are trying to solve. Anyone already using a heavy protein treatment in their routine should also be cautious about layering this on top, as excess protein without adequate moisture balance can make hair feel brittle over time.
